Many people refer to anything other than a sedan as a truck. . SUV is the marketing name. Its still a rose or whatever you want to call it
An RX isn't marketed as a truck... or even as an SUV. It's a Crossover, which is an SUV built on the chassis of a sedan. An SUV "truck" would be along the lines of a Toyota Forerunner, which actually is built on a truck chassis. Test drive them both, and the difference is clear.

First impressions coming from a 2013 RX AWD to a similar 2020 version................

* some changes with transmission or shift points as vehicle is more responsive at the lower end but sometimes can't decide where it wants to settle (in normal setting)
* miss some of the storage in center console
* drives very similarly to 2013 but maybe slightly stiffer suspension as advertised. Noticed it thus far rounding corners at 40 and above mph.......less roll
* certainly more safety features now but don't chose to use them all........do like the cross traffic alert in rear camera especially
* wish they still had the true silver ext color choice. Atomic Silver has a taupe look to it but nice
* seems like more room in the back seat area
* dash appears larger and flatter which is fine for placing items on while traveling
* glad I held out for 2020 vs 2019 if only for the bigger screen and closer placement to driver I'm told
* still wish they would incorporate a cup holder for larger diameter cups
* no problem with the new touch pad design
* wife says headrests are different.......she preferred the 2013 which didn't push up against the back of head as much

..........smooth, quiet, comfortable, and dependable just like the 2013.......thus far anyway. Hard to beat

While RX does not automatically lock itself when you walk away, it will automatically lock when,

(RX is not locked)
Open driver door
Push Start button without braking. The radio and etc will be on.
Push Start button again without braking. Everything should be on except the engine is not running
Push Start button again to turn everything off.
Close driver door
RX will lock itself!

Only found it this morning when I tried to check how much gas left in my RX.

My first impressions of my new RX.

THE GOOD.
HUD I would highly recommend this option
PANARAMIC MONITOR very useful for parking.

THE NOT SO GOOD
LANE TRACING This doesn't work well on my car, maybe it needs some adjustment, if that's possible. It hugs the left side of the lane , then sometimes drifts over the line. It's unreliable, I keep it turned off.
REAR SEAT SWITCHES These don't work. I have to take it in to get the rear seat recline switches checked out and working.
ANDROID AUTO I was hopeing to use WAZE , but it's not available on AA yet. I have Lexus Navigation, so the AA app is useless for me.
Also I have to keep it plugged into the USB port of the center console for it to work. The only app I would use it for is Amazon music, but I can get that through Bluetooth.

That's it until I think of anything else to add.

The only data-capable USB ports are in the center console. The dash ports and the ones in the back are power-only. It's goofy that the dash ports aren't data-capable, since the phone holder is right there .

In case you haven't tried Google Maps as an alternative to Waze, you might. I like it better than Waze, now that the most useful features are at parity. AA needs to fully catch up, as some Maps features, like current speed, don't display in AA.

Ditto on the panoramic view monitor. It is very helpful with parking.

I found that if I am listening to the radio or siriusXM that I can rewind and listen to the same song over again! To do this have the radio panel displayed to the right of maps. When the song ends press the double left arrow , bottom left, and they song will replay as many times as you do this!
